Studio One, the legendary Jamaican label that pioneered the reggae, ska and dancehall crazes and sparked the careers of Bob Marley, Alton Ellis, Jackie Mittoo and dozens of other reggae luminaries, have released thousands of essential reggae classics over its unrivaled six-decade long history. The label also had many iconic imprints, with one of the most sought-after being singles issued on the Coxsone imprint (named after Studio One founder and “father of reggae music” Coxsone Dodd) with instantly recognizable blue labels. These singles have come to be known as “Blue Coxsone” in collector’s circles and fetch tidy sums given their limited release and rarity.

In the later part of 1967, Studio One releases on the iconic blue Coxsone label began appearing in the UK. The run of singles eventually numbered over 100 and included many of the label’s top rocksteady output from artists like Ken Boothe, The Heptones, Bob Andy, Joe Higgs, and the legendary Soul Vendors, who all extended the swinging scene in Kingston, Jamaica all the way to England. The Soul Vendors themselves were fresh from a visit to the UK backing up a set of the label’s artists.

This limited edition box set features six rare singles all reproduced on the original Blue Coxsone label featuring essential tunes from Joe Higgs, Winston Jarrett, The Sound Dimension, The Melodians and other Studio One icons. Also included is a previously unreleased Blue Coxsone single, CS 7073 – The Sound Dimension covering “Walk Don’t Run” b/w Trevor Clarke’s “Giving Up On Love”.
